当前,全球环境正面临着复杂又深刻的变化,而科技创新是数字化浪潮下助力社会不断向前发展的驱动力。用科技和善良创造美好,深耕工程师文化成为越来越多科技企业发展的理念。正如 9 月 14 日刚刚举办的2022 谷歌开发者大会「共码未来 Code for Better_ 」上,我们看到了来自谷歌技术专家及全球开发者们带来的精彩议题及最新技术专题演讲视频,其中覆盖谷歌 24 个产品线和话题,包括开发工具、平台和产品的动态与技术展示,还有持续更新的 Google 开发者在线课程资源,以助力开发更高效,拓展更多知识技能。
大会首日的大咖技术演讲,包含主旨演讲和技术专题演讲,其中主旨演讲部分由 Google 大中华区总裁陈俊廷、Google 北京研发中心总经理陆韵晟、Google 开发技术推广工程师陈卓等带来精彩分享。
大会主旨演讲开篇时,Google 大中华区总裁陈俊廷表示“从诞生之日起,谷歌就一直在致力于整合全球信息供大众使用、使人受益的使命”。正如此次开发者大会的主题「共码未来 Code for Better_」, 科技是振奋人心的,更振奋人心的是看到这些科技能够为大家带来什么帮助。期待谷歌在科技和产品领域不断创新提升,帮助开发者和合作伙伴共同打造面向当今和未来的产品。
主旨演讲环节,Google 北京研发中心总经理陆韵晟也带来了精彩分享。陆韵晟表示,“开发者面对未来不设限的精神给我们的学习、交流、生活、工作等方面都带来了极大的便捷”。过去的一年里,中国的开发者在全球舞台上扮演着越来越重要的角色。“共码未来”的旅程中,谷歌将继续携手开发者和合作伙伴用平台和产品来助力打造激动人心的产品和服务,积极参与全球化大趋势, 帮助中国文化创作者出海,继续关注人才培养以推进谷歌使命的实现(Code for Better Knowledge ),进一步探索创新以帮助开发者和全球用户链接(Code for Better Connection)。
随后,Google 开发技术推广工程师陈卓带来了关于Android 的最新动态。陈卓表示,Android 平台不断改善和影响着人们的生活,在助力开发者为用户打造全天候,精彩,无缝体验的同时,包括 Android Studio 和 Kotlin 编程语言等在内的技术、工具及平台也提供了更全面的功能和更高效的开发体验,为开发者们提供了可触达全球数十亿用户的机会。其备受关注的可穿戴设备如 Jetpack Compose Wear OS 版,也帮助开发者们构建更精美的可穿戴设备应用且遵循最佳的开发体验,并为触达和连接用户提供新机会。在开发者生产力更新方面,陈卓介绍称,为了帮助开发者们更快更轻松地构建 Android 应用,Android 团队在系统和工具链方面都做了很多的改进和更新。最新版本的 Android Studio 中包括了对 Jetpack Compose的强力支持;而最新的 Compose 1.2 稳定版则加入了可加载字、嵌套滚动不操作等新功能,来帮助开发者们更轻松地在不同设备上构建出色的应用体验。
Google Play 大中华区业务发展总监张雷也带来了关于 Google Play 的精彩分享。张雷表示,面对当前充满挑战的全球大环境, Android 和 Google Play 持续为中国开发者提供了可触及全球市场、被数以十亿计用户提供服务的平台。Google Play 生态中获得成功的关键——用户信任,因此对于安全、用户数据和隐私的保护等问题始终是 Google Play 的核心。Google Play 为开发者们提供了全新的 SDK 检索(SDK Index)功能,便于开发者们选择集成管理和更安全地使用 SDK。另外,App Signing 和 Cloud Key Management 结合以及 Play Integrity API 进一步强化了对开发者的应用免遭盗版和其他欺诈活动侵害的保护。关于 Apps 对用户的数据收集问题上,Google Play Store 的 Data Safety Section 可让用户更直观地了解该问题,而 Privacy Sandbox on Android 解决方案已推动更有利于保护隐私的广告投放,以更高品质的产品赢得用户的信任,在用户获取、参与度提升、全球市场拓展等多方面持续通过产品和合作为开发者们提供助力。
随后,来自 Google Firebase 团队的开发技术推广工程师 Sumit Chandel 带来了关于 Firebase平台发的技术分享。Sumit 表示,团队将继续致力于提供使应用开发变得更快、更轻松的工具,加强 Firebase 与 Google 最受开发者欢迎的产品的集成,使 Firebase 平台与开放的工具生态系统更好地协同工作,以帮助监测应用质量,让大家的业务发展速度跟上全球用户群的 增长。基于 Firebase 的 Flutter 插件都已全面集成可用,支持添加官方 Flutter 文档、代码片段和提供客户支持等功能。面对跨平台开发的棘手问题,更新的 Crashlytics 支持在 Android Studio 中更好地调试应用,且新推出了 App Quality Insights 窗口,开发者无需切换工具,便可在 Android Studio 中发现并调查 Crashlytics 报告的问题。
Google Flutter 团队产品经理樊舟颖也带来了关于 Flutter 技术分享。樊舟颖介绍称,Flutter 为革新用户界面开发而生,它融合了 Web 的迭代开发模式和硬件加速的图形引擎,实现了此前只能在游戏中才能做到的像素级别的精细控制。新推出的 Flutter 3.3 版本也进行了性能改进,还增加了许多开发者翘首以盼的功能。新推出的 Flutter 休闲游戏工具包也通过游戏开发模板、学习资料等资源帮助简化游戏开发工作,助力开发者将出色的创意落地转化为正式发布的游戏。
Google 资深开发技术推广工程师兼 Chrome 开发技术推广部主任 Paul Kinlan表示,Chrome 团队致力于帮助开发者构建 Web 并推动浏览器的更多可能性,整个生态系统合作提升浏览器兼容性以支持框架、工具和库的使用。Web 联手其他浏览器供应商共同建立了 Interop 2022 标准,帮助解决开发“痛点” ,让开发者能够不必一直担心兼容性问题,集中精力为用户开发丰富的 Web 体验。同时也继续提升 Chrome DevTools 以提供触手可得的最佳工具和指导。同时 Web 也在试验新的 Web API——共享元素转换, 将原本只能在原生应用实现的精美转场动画带到 Web 中。
Google 上海研发中心总经理魏晓倩也分享了作为女性工程师身份参加本次大会的感悟,期待能传递多元、平等和共融的文化,与开发者共同构建更加开放和有温度的开发者社区。谷歌持续助力 Google 开发者社区举办丰富有意义的活动,今年由 Google 开发者社区主导的 DevFest 系列活动有超过20场。Women Techmakers 社区也举办了丰富的交流互动以持续赋能中国的女性开发者们,并期待通过社区的资源去赋能中国的女性开发者们业。魏晓倩还分享了不少谷歌众多“贯穿无障碍功能与共融设计理念“的产品,如支持 80 多种语言及方言实时转化为文字信息,在没有网络的情况下也能使用的 Live Transcribe ,不仅能直接地为残障人士的生活提供便利,也同样能为非残障人士带来方便,足以体现共融的设计理念对于谷歌产品的重要性。
最后,Google Developer X 开发技术推广部副总裁兼总经理 Jeanine Banks 为主旨演讲做了总结。Jeanine Banks 表示,谷歌致力于为开发者构建产品提供技术和工具支持,通过提升开发产品的协同,提供指导和最佳实践这两方面,帮助开发者更便捷地改进工作流程。例如 Flutter 3.3 等更新都是在帮助开发者使用谷歌技术和工具更好地协同工作。同时,谷歌也致力于投资和支持开源技术和社区,确保教育向所有人开放,让更多人获益。谷歌持续更新 Google 开发者在线课程的学习资源,帮助开发者加速提升技能,拓展知识。接下来也希望更多开发者能够开始了解自己最喜爱的产品的最新功能,以此来创新向前,惠及他人,“使人人受益”,这也是谷歌作为一家全球科技企业的一直积极促成的发展理念。
点击链接,了解更多大会精彩~